SebSharp
Messages postés10Date d'inscriptionmercredi 10 septembre 2003StatutMembreDernière intervention26 mai 2004
-
5 janv. 2004 à 08:34
toutiwai
Messages postés4Date d'inscriptionsamedi 6 mars 2004StatutMembreDernière intervention 6 août 2005
-
28 mai 2004 à 09:06
Salut a tous,
Est ce qu'il est possible en C# pour un comboBox de ne pas limiter la vue du contenu si la taille du comboBox est plus petit que le texte afficher dans le comboBox.
SebSharp
Messages postés10Date d'inscriptionmercredi 10 septembre 2003StatutMembreDernière intervention26 mai 2004 15 janv. 2004 à 07:50
En fait, un combobox a une taille fixe a l'écran mais le texte contenu dans le combobox peut être plus grand que cette taille, et ce que je veux c'est la possibilité d'afficher ce texte entièrement après avoir cliquer sur le combobox.
Donc que la zone qui apparait pour afficher la liste j'aimerais qu'elle soit plus grande que la taille du combobox
TheSaib, j'espère que c'est plus clair sinon previens moi.
cs_JLD2
Messages postés6Date d'inscriptionjeudi 22 janvier 2004StatutMembreDernière intervention23 janvier 2004 23 janv. 2004 à 12:17
A mon avis, t'as deux solutions expérimentalement tu comptes combien de caractères tu peux mettre en fonction de la largeur en pixels de ta combobox et au moment de changer le text de ta combobox tu la redimentionne si nécessaire. Mais à mon avis c'est foireux, car le design de ta fenetre risque d'être bizarre par moment.
Ou alors ajoute un evenement mouse enter à ta combo box et quand la souris est dessus tu vérifies que le texte ne sois pas trop grand, si le cas tu sors un ToolTip avec le texte complet de l'item de ta checkbox.
Pour l'utilisation du tooltip tu peux voir ça dans la doc du framework